Skip to main content

Search hotels in Excelsior Springs, MO

Enter your dates to see the latest prices and deals for Excelsior Springs hotels

Excelsior Springs – 7 hotels and places to stay

Hotels with parking in Excelsior Springs

See reviews by guests who stayed at hotels in Excelsior Springs

See all
  • From US$227.14 per night
    Scored out of 10, guest rating 8.7
    Fabulous - What previous guests thought, 134 reviews
    The Elms is absolutely gorgeous! Spacious areas that are well maintained and very nicely decorated. Great restaurants, bars, deli, small store, banquet areas, pool, workout equipment, games, and so much more! Rooms are lovely and very comfortable! There is nothing to dislike!
    Guest review by
    Elizabeth
    United States
  • From US$227.14 per night
    Scored out of 10, guest rating 8.7
    Fabulous - What previous guests thought, 134 reviews
    The Hotel facility is very up to date and classy. The lobby is spacious and inviting. Our evening dinner at the.Three Owls Restaurant was excellent… good food and a lovely atmosphere. The spa facility is outstanding.
    Guest review by
    KATHLEEN
    United States
  • From US$227.14 per night
    Scored out of 10, guest rating 8.7
    Fabulous - What previous guests thought, 134 reviews
    The hot tub outside was amazing. Also the holiday decor in the lobby and throughout the hotel was very well done. The staff was also helpful and friendly.
    Guest review by
    Angela
    United States
  • From US$227.14 per night
    Scored out of 10, guest rating 8.7
    Fabulous - What previous guests thought, 134 reviews
    History of the hotel was very cool and staff very proud and knowledgeable about it. Very comfortable bed. Lovely restaurant/bar.
    Guest review by
    Rachael
    United Kingdom
  • From US$227.14 per night
    Scored out of 10, guest rating 8.7
    Fabulous - What previous guests thought, 134 reviews
    Gorgeous hotel. Cute town
    Guest review by
    Kim
    Germany